About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Pump Applications Engineer to join our team at DXP Enterprises. As a key member of our engineering department, you will be responsible for designing, selecting, and configuring pumps, pumping systems, and fluid handling systems to meet the needs of our industrial customers.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design and select pumps, pumping systems, and fluid handling systems to meet customer requirements
  • Support the applications engineering department with rotating equipment sizing, pricing, and quoting
  • Field incoming calls and emails from customers and partner manufacturers to discuss equipment applications
  • Understand customer's pumping system and its issues to offer the best solution
  • Make equipment recommendations and prepare quotations
  • Coordinate project bids, encompassing the review of technical specifications and bid documents, design and selection of equipment, and preparation of a bid or quotation
  • Assist with the follow-up of quotations and communicate with outside sales to determine the best course of action
  • Process orders for new equipment into DXP's business operating system
  • Provide technical support to outside sales, service shop, customer service / aftermarket parts group, and customers
  • Project manage orders, maintain organization of order and project files, monitor project status, and assist with project-related questions
  • Generate Bill of Materials and Work Orders, work with shop personnel during assembly
  • Work with factory personnel to acquire appropriate documentation for submittals, assemble final manuals, and schedule equipment start-up and training once a project is completed
  • Occasionally travel with outside sales personnel to visit with customers to discuss potential grass-roots projects and replacement of existing equipment
  • Participate in applicable equipment training sessions
  • Log quotations and keep their status up to date

Requirements:

  • Engineering degree, Mechanical Engineering preferred; all Engineering disciplines are encouraged to apply
  • Knowledge of centrifugal pumps, mixers, heat exchangers, valves, piping, and fabricated systems
  • Three or more years of applicable pump, fluid handling, or other rotating equipment experience
  • Project management experience
  • Experience with Epicor Prophet 21, DXP's Business Operating System
  • Negotiating skills
  • Sales experience
